Skip to content

This repository contains a variety of well-crafted code examples that are ideal for practice. Enjoy!!

Notifications You must be signed in to change notification settings

LoneExpert/Algorithm-s-and-Code

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

17 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Algorithm and Code...

Welcome to the Algorithm and Code repository!!! This repository contains a collection of solved problems and implementations of various algorithms across a range of topics. The aim of this repository is to serve as a resource for learning, practicing, and mastering different algorithmic techniques.

The repository covers the following topics:

  1. Trees

  2. Linked Lists

  3. Subsequences

  4. Recursion

  5. Sorting Algorithm

  6. Spoj

  7. String

  8. Array

  9. Permutation

  10. Heap

  11. Hashmap

  12. Graphs

  13. Dynamic Programming (DP)

  14. Bit Manupulation

  15. many more...

    HOW TO USE

    1. Clone the repository: git clone https://github.com/your-username/Algorithm-and-Code.git
    2. Navigate to the desired topic folder: cd Algorithm-and-Code/Trees (for example)
    3. Explore the solutions and implementations: a. Each file is named after the problem or algorithm it solves. b. Read the code comments and documentation within each file for detailed explanations.
    4. Compile and run the solutions: a. Most of the solutions are written in C++. b. Use a C++ compiler to compile and run the code.

    Contributing

    Contributions are welcome! If you have solved additional problems, optimized existing solutions, or implemented new algorithms, feel free to contribute:

    1. Fork the repository.
    2. Create a new branch: git checkout -b feature-branch
    3. Make your changes and commit them: git add --a and then git commit -m "Description of changes"
    4. Push to the branch: git push origin feature-branch
    5. Create a pull request: Please ensure your code follows the existing coding style and include comments where necessary.

    Contact

    For any questions or feedback, feel free to reach out:

    GitHub: LoneExpert || Email: [email protected] Happy coding!!